Description
This comprehensive work offers an extensive exploration of natural sciences, delving into the various branches that encompass the study of nature. Cuvier, a pioneering figure in the field, meticulously details concepts, classifications, and essential terminologies that relate to the natural world. The text serves not only as a reference for scholars and enthusiasts but also as an enlightening resource for readers looking to deepen their understanding of natural history and the processes governing life on Earth.
In addition to the scientific entries, the work includes a biographical section that highlights the lives and contributions of some of the most renowned naturalists in history. This dual approach provides readers with insight into the individuals who have shaped the field, linking their discoveries to the scientific principles outlined throughout the dictionary. Cuvier’s eloquent writing captures the essence of natural inquiry, making it accessible to both experts and those new to the discipline.
